Introduction to the Series

Dragon Ball Z is an iconic anime that has captivated audiences worldwide with its thrilling storylines, dynamic characters, and intense battles. Originally released in 1989 as a sequel to the original Dragon Ball series, Dragon Ball Z quickly gained popularity for its unique blend of action, humor, and emotional depth. This anime, based on Akira Toriyama's manga, transcends generational boundaries, appealing to fans of all ages due to its universal themes of friendship, perseverance, and self-discovery.

Staff and Cast Details

Behind the scenes, Dragon Ball Z boasts a team of talented individuals who have brought this epic saga to life. Key staff members include directors such as Daisuke Nishio and writers like Takao Koyama, whose creative vision shaped the series. Additionally, prominent animators like Minoru Maeda played a pivotal role in crafting the iconic fight scenes that have become synonymous with Dragon Ball Z. The cast list features renowned voice actors like Masako Nozawa (Goku) and Ryō Horikawa (Vegeta), whose exceptional performances have added depth and emotion to the characters.

Comparison with Crunchyroll

Scrutinizing the content library of Dragon Ball Z on Funimation in comparison to Crunchyroll unveils interesting nuances. Crunchyroll, known for its extensive collection of anime titles, provides a vast array of series beyond Dragon Ball Z. The key characteristic of Crunchyroll lies in its emphasis on a broad range of niche, classic, and simulcasted anime. This diversity establishes Crunchyroll as a beneficial choice for anime aficionados seeking a wide spectrum of content genres. The unique feature of Crunchyroll's library is its focus on subbed anime, catering to viewers who prefer original Japanese voiceovers with subtitles.

Distinguishing Features

When examining the distinguishing features of Funimation against Crunchyroll, a notable aspect emerges. Funimation's strength lies in its curated selection of dubbed anime, including Dragon Ball Z. This appeals to an audience interested in English-language dubbing options, enhancing accessibility for a broader demographic. The robust dubbing capabilities of Funimation elevate its standing as a popular choice for those seeking dubbed anime content. However, an inherent disadvantage may arise for viewers favoring subtitled content, as Funimation's primary focus tends towards dubbed offerings.
